Season 3 of The Traitors concluded last night with Gabby, Ivar, Dolores, and Dylan splitting the $204,300 prize pot. This was the most Faithful to finish the game together, delivering a lighthearted ending to an otherwise cutthroat season.
Of course, a season wouldn’t be complete without a reunion hosted by Andy Cohen, but in the past, these reunions have felt inconsequential. This year’s followed suit and there wasn’t a ton of drama for the players to discuss. The four winners and their “kumbaya” ending

In past finales, we’ve seen Faithful dreams get crushed at the Fire of Truth. Honestly, some of us are still bitter about how they did Mercedes Javid in Season 2.
In comparison, Season 3’s finale was a lot less dramatic, with the four Faithful players all choosing to end the game. There was no greed and no betrayal. Although some fans feel like that made for an anticlimactic ending, the winners explained to Andy that it all came down to trust.
“They really just like drove us into the ground, those Traitors,” Gabby explained. “I feel like by the end, I’m like ‘Come on,’ yeah it’s a little kumbaya, but I feel like we all really trusted each other.”
For Dylan, he said he felt confident about Britney’s banishment at the final roundtable. Her argument was so solid that he knew she had to be guilty of something. Therefore, he felt confident ending the game with the remaining players. Meanwhile, Ivar and Dolores were just happy to be there.
Carolyn felt disrespected in the castle

What would Season 3 of The Traitors have been without sweet, sweet Carolyn? The Survivor alum and her facial expressions had the Faithfuls confused, the Traitors annoyed, and the audience intrigued. During the reunion, Andy asked if she felt “respected” by her fellow Traitors, and that’s when the tears started flowing. According to Carolyn, she never felt the love.
“I felt it. I saw it,” Carlyn said of the disrespect in the castle.
Danielle tried to chop it up to miscommunication, but even Gabby said she saw the disrespect towards Carolyn when watching the season. It’s not a miscommunication to call someone dumb and compare them to Forrest Gump.
Ultimately, it’s all water under the bridge now. Neither of them won, and as Dolores pointed out, Carolyn is now raking in a lot of money on Cameo. She gained a whole lot of new fans from this experience, and that’s a prize in itself.
Danielle has zero regrets about her gameplay

The most controversial Traitor of Season 3 was definitely Danielle. Her theatrics and questionable strategies left the audience at home confused and slightly annoyed. We’re all watching her and thinking, “How can they not tell she’s a Traitor?”
To make matters worse, Danielle was going around the castle swearing on her grandkids, and she made it very clear at the reunion that she didn’t feel bad about it. We’re not sure what’s more shocking — the fact that she’s someone’s grandma or the fact that she had no regrets about swearing on their lives.
Although Danielle got a lot of criticism for her gameplay, Andy pointed out that she still did pretty well in the game, all things considered. She outlasted all of the original Traitors this season, and she almost made it to the finale. It seems like her only regret from this show was trusting Britney.
Bob the Drag Queen took on the Housewives

The Traitors kicked off the season by targeting Housewives, so of course, they had to answer to that at the reunion. Andy was like “Why the f*ck did you go after the Housewives?”
With that in mind, Dorinda came out on the stage in her Ferragamo dress ready to play. She felt salty about getting murdered first and even saltier that Bob the Drag Queen went around joking about it on social media once the show aired.
“I didn’t dislike you, I just murdered you,” Bob told the Real Housewives of New York alum.
Never in a million years did we think we’d see Dorinda and Bob going back and forth at a reunion moderated by Andy, but we’re so glad it happened. Props to Bob for surviving that encounter. Tinsley Mortimer could never.
Ayan also had some smoke for Bob, but it was lighthearted. She said that Bob murdered her because she was the funniest person in the castle. In her mind, Bob was threatened by her star power. Bob was like, “Call me when you have two comedy specials.”
